Identification of a Vibrio cholerae chemoreceptor that senses taurine and amino acids as attractants.
Scientific reports - 16 Feb 2016
Nishiyama So-ichiro, Takahashi Yohei, Yamamoto Kentaro, Suzuki Daisuke, Itoh Yasuaki, Sumita Kazumasa, Uchida Yumiko, Homma Michio, Imada Katsumi, Kawagishi Ikuro
Abstract excerpt
Vibrio cholerae, the etiological agent of cholera, was found to be attracted by taurine (2-aminoethanesulfonic acid), a major constituent of human bile. Mlp37, the closest homolog of the previously identified amino acid chemoreceptor Mlp24, was found to mediate taxis to taurine as well as L-serine, L-alanine, L-arginine, and other amino acids.
